@article{165714, author = {Preeti Gupta and Omprakash Sinha}, title = {Identification of Papaya Disease Using a Deep Learning Approach}, journal = {International Journal of Innovative Research in Technology}, year = {2024}, volume = {11}, number = {1}, pages = {1789-1794}, issn = {2349-6002}, url = {https://ijirt.org/article?manuscript=165714}, abstract = {Papaya disease poses a significant threat to farmers worldwide, leading to substantial losses annually. Recognizing the urgency of mitigating these losses, researchers have increasingly focused on developing papaya disease recognition systems. However, farmers often lack awareness of detection techniques, resulting in disease identification only after the papayas are already affected, leading to wasted crops and financial losses. Consequently, many farmers are hesitant to continue papaya cultivation. To address this issue, we conducted research leveraging deep learning technology for papaya disease detection and classification}, keywords = {Papaya Diseases, Deep Learning, Keras, Classification.}, month = {June}, }
